Shooting 73, 71, 75, 75 Issy has finished with a +2 and 5th overall at the Aussie Girls’ Amateur. The standout Queensland player, Issy competed against Australia’s top juniors at the Port Kembla course all vying for the coveted title.

What a difference a year makes… In 2016 Issy travelled with Golf Queensland as a development player to the Aussie Juniors and finished T20. This year the 16 year old is Captain of the Queensland Girls team and proving that she’s a top pick for representative golf also being selected for the Queensland Women’s Team to play in WA in May.

Goes without saying I’m a very proud coach! As Issy balances her year 11 academic workload with her golf, my focus is to continue to improve Issy’s game by combining technique with golf fitness gym sessions and help with mental strength so she can make good decisions under any playing conditions.

Starting tomorrow the Queensland team will compete in the Girls’ Interstate Teams event which is a series of Matchplay rounds. Having made the Matchplay quarterfinals at the recent 2017 NSW Amateur I know Issy will bring her best golf to lead the Queensland team. Go Issy keep up the effort.
